K. S. CORP. v. CHEMSTRAND CORPORATION


203 F.Supp. 230 (1962)

K. S. CORP., Plaintiff, v. The CHEMSTRAND CORPORATION and Fabrex Corp., Defendants.

United States District Court S. D. New York.

January 19, 1962.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Royall, Koegel & Rogers, New York City, Frederick W. P. Lorenzen and Laura Chapman Hruska, New York City, of counsel, for plaintiff.

Shearman & Sterling, New York City, for defendant Chemstrand Corporation.

Hahn, Hessen, Margolis & Ryan, New York City, for defendant Fabrex Corp.


PALMIERI, District Judge.

Defendant The Chemstrand Corporation (Chemstrand) has moved for an order sustaining its objections to certain interrogatories propounded by plaintiff in a private treble damage action against Chemstrand, a manufacturer of synthetic fibers, and Fabrex Corp.
